site stats

Branch-and-bound algorithm

WebMar 24, 2024 · Branch and bound algorithms are a variety of adaptive partition strategies have been proposed to solve global optimization models. These are based upon … WebAug 17, 2024 · If the upper bound of the solutions from S1 is lower than the lower bound of the solutions in S2, then obviously it is not worth exploring the solutions in S2. This is the whole magic behind the branch and …

Branch and bound - Wikipedia

WebA C++ implementation of the Branch and Bound algorithm for solving the Travelling Salesman Problem - GitHub - piotrdurniat/tsp-branch-and-bound: A C++ implementation ... WebThe word, Branch and Bound refers to all the state space search methods in which we generate the childern of all the expanded nodes, before making any live node as an expanded one. In this method, we find the most … meal options in emirates https://ghitamusic.com

The Knapsack Problem OR-Tools Google Developers

WebA branch-bound algorithm is then used to solve the pr... View. A generic view at the Dantzig-Wolfe decomposition approach in Mixed Integer Programming: paving the way for a generic code Motivation. WebThe General Branch and Bound Algorithm . Each solution is assumed to be expressible as an array X[1:n] (as was seen in Backtracking). A predictor, called an approximate cost function CC, is assumed to have been defined. Definitions: A live node is a node that has not been expanded A dead node is a node that has been expanded WebBranch-and-Bound. Mixed Integer Linear Programming problems are generally solved using a linear-programming based branch-and-bound algorithm. Overview. Basic LP-based branch-and-bound can be … meal options for senior citizens

Branch and bound - SlideShare

Category:Branch and bound - javatpoint

Tags:Branch-and-bound algorithm

Branch-and-bound algorithm

Branch-and-Bound Algorithm - an overview ScienceDirect Topics

WebMar 23, 2024 · The branch and bound algorithm create branches and bounds for the best solution. In this tutorial, we’ll discuss the branch and bound method in detail. Different search techniques in branch and … WebBranch-and-Bound Technique for Solving Integer Programs Author Unknown Basic Concepts The basic concept underlying the branch-and-bound technique is to divide and conquer. Since the original “large” problem is hard to solve directly, it is divided into smaller and smaller subproblems until these subproblems can be conquered. The dividing ...

Branch-and-bound algorithm

Did you know?

WebBranch and Bound An algorithm design technique, primarily for solving hard optimization problems Guarantees that the optimal solution will be found Does not necessarily … WebWe shall also be using the fixed-size solution here. Another thing to be noted here is that this problem is a maximization problem, whereas the Branch and Bound method is for minimization problems. Hence, the values will be multiplied by -1 so that this problem gets converted into a minimization problem. Now, consider the 0/1 knapsack problem ...

WebJan 7, 2024 · The counterpoint is that, without good heuristics, branch-and-bound can take centuries to converge instead of seconds. Implementation. W.r.t. data structures, it doesn't really matter to be honest, because the cost of managing the tree is insignificant compared to the cost of everything else in a branch-and-bound algorithm, especially in C++. WebMar 18, 2024 · Branch and bound is a method of designing algorithms commonly used to solve combinatorial optimization problems. In the worst-case scenario, these problems …

WebDec 21, 2024 · Branch and Cut for is a variation of the Branch and Bound algorithm. Branch and Cut incorporates Gomery cuts allowing the search space of the given problem. The standard Simplex Algorithm will be used to solve each Integer Linear Programming Problem (LP). : .. < =, =,,, Above is a mix-integer linear programming problem. x and c … WebBranch and Bound makes passive use of this principle, in that sub-optimal paths are never favoured over optimal paths. A variant of Branch and Bound, called A* Search (A-star …

WebComputational results are presented for a parallel branch and bound algorithm that optimally solves the asymmetric traveling salesman problem. The algorithm uses an …

Webbound on the optimal value over a given region – upper bound can be found by choosing any point in the region, or by a local optimization method – lower bound can be found … meal optionsWebA Branch and Bound Based on NSGAII Algorithm for Multi-Objective Mixed Integer Non Linear Optimization Problems: Author: Ahmed Jaber Pascal Lafon Rafic Younes : DOI: … meal or mealsWebon a branch-and-bound tree. We address the key challenge of learning an adap-tive node searching order for any class of problem solvable by branch-and-bound. Our strategies … meal options mhwWebFeb 1, 2016 · A Lagrangian-Based Branch-and-Bound Algorithm for the Two-Level Uncapacitated Facility Location Problem with Single-Assignment Constraints. Technical Report CIRRELT-2013-21. CIRRELT (2013) Google Scholar [77] D.T. Phan. Lagrangian duality and branch-and-bound algorithms for optimal power flow. pearlboy chapter 60 manga.kioWebFeb 20, 2012 · 1. It sounds like you need to dynamically allocate arrays of your structs and then link them to nodes in your structs. To do this, you would add a pointer to the … meal options wedding invitationsWebThe Branch and Bound Algorithm. The Relaxed Mixed Integer Nonlinear Programming (RMINLP) model is initially solved using the starting point provided by the modeler. SBB will stop immediately if the RMINLP model is unbounded or infeasible, or if it fails (see option infeasseq and failseq below for an exception). If all discrete variables in the ... pearlbird mask outwardWebOct 30, 2024 · Branch and bound is a search algorithm used for combinatory, discrete, and general mathematical optimization problems. It is comparable to backtracking in that … pearlbrook castlerock